GE Aerospace Lead Engineer - Electrical Component in Evendale, Ohio

Job Description Summary

Find excitement by continuing your career at GE Aerospace! As a lead engineer in electrical system components, you will have the opportunity to support current key defense systems and develop next generation technologies! The Evendale Large Military Electrical Systems team is responsible for the design, support, and problem solving for electrical components and electrical systems for many legacy military applications. Additionally, the team is responsible for new design and technology upgrades as well as advanced technology demonstration and support. This team has the rare opportunity for exposure to the entire life cycle of military aviation products and requires the unique combination of technical expertise, influencing skills, and project management.

Job Description

Roles and Responsibilities

  • Take full ownership of a range of hardware as you develop expertise and sharpen critical engineering skills required to succeed in the industry.

  • Manage individual projects as part of cross-functional teams including creating and updating proposal documents, leading design reviews, and reviewing technical information

  • Usher critical technology through the full design process from concept to production

  • Verify and document that electrical components from supplier meet customer requirements for performance and integration

  • Take advantage of both breadth and depth of knowledge of an industry leader as you learn to implement aerospace standards and best practices.

  • Exercise troubleshooting skills as part of a multi-disciplined team to resolve real-time issues of fielded assets as they arise

  • Integrate complex sensing systems architecture into turbomachinery

Required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in engineering from an accredited university or college

  • Minimum of 3 years of experience in design engineering
